Volcano-boarding down Cerro Negro's black ash is the kind of thing you do once and dine out on forever. Nicaragua keeps adventure cheap: colonial Granada, the twin volcanoes of Ometepe rising out of a vast lake, surf towns down the Pacific side. The government is a hard autocracy, so keep your politics to yourself while you're there and don't post commentary until you're home.
Intentional homicides per 100,000 people โ lower is better.
Nicaragua: 5.5
Ranked 66th in the world for the highest homicide rate.
5.45 homicides per 100,000 people in 2023 โ an elevated rate by world standards.
Higher than 62% of the 230 countries and territories measured.
How peaceful the country is โ lower is better.
Nicaragua: 2.2
Ranked 53rd least peaceful country in the world.
More peaceful than 32% of the 163 countries ranked, scoring 2.207.
Up 2 places since 2024.
Personal and economic freedom โ higher is better.
Nicaragua: 4.8
Ranked 22nd least free country in the world.
Less free than 92% of the 165 countries measured โ 4.85 out of 10.
Day-to-day life (speech, movement, religion) scores 3.72; doing business and owning property, 6.43.
LGBT+ equality in law and daily life โ higher is better.
Nicaragua: 4.5
Ranked 81st most equal in the world for LGBT+ people.
Better for LGBT+ equality than 57% of the 197 countries scored โ 45 out of 100.
The law runs ahead of public opinion here โ legal protections score 50 out of 100, everyday attitudes 40.
